看广告app赚金币系统软件app开发 源码搭建
| 更新时间 2025-01-03 18:18:00 价格 请来电询价 联系电话 13724186946 联系手机 13724186946 联系人 王松松 立即询价 |
开发一个看广告赚金币的系统软件App并进行源码搭建是一个复杂但具有潜力的项目。以下是一个详细的步骤指南,帮助你从头开始构建这样的应用:
一、明确需求与规划确定核心功能:
用户注册与登录:确保用户能够安全地注册和登录应用。
广告展示与播放:集成广告SDK,实现广告的展示和播放功能。
金币获取与展示:设计金币的获取机制,并在应用中展示用户的金币余额。
提现功能(可选):如果计划让用户将金币兑换为现金,需要实现提现功能。
设计用户界面(UI)和用户体验(UX):
创建吸引人的UI设计,包括主页、广告播放页、金币商店等。
确保UX设计简洁、直观,便于用户导航和操作。
前端技术:
选择适合移动应用开发的框架,如React Native、Flutter、原生iOS(Swift)或原生Android(Java/Kotlin)。
后端技术:
选择后端开发框架(如Node.js、Django、Spring Boot等)和数据库系统(如MySQL、PostgreSQL、MongoDB等)。
广告SDK:
选择主流的广告SDK,如Google AdMob、Facebook Ads等,用于在应用中展示广告。
开发工具与环境:
安装所需的开发工具,如代码编辑器、版本控制系统(Git)、移动应用开发环境等。
配置后端服务器和数据库环境。
用户系统:
实现用户注册、登录、个人信息管理等功能。
广告模块:
集成广告SDK,实现广告的展示、点击和关闭事件监听。
根据用户观看广告的行为,给予相应的金币奖励。
金币系统:
实现金币的赚取、消耗和查询功能。
用户可以在金币商店中使用金币购买虚拟道具或参与特殊活动。
其他功能:
实现用户反馈、分享、提现请求(如果需要)等功能。
API接口:
为前端提供数据交互的API接口,如用户信息、广告请求、游戏数据、金币记录等。
数据处理:
处理用户请求,与数据库交互,返回所需数据。
实现金币的增减逻辑,并记录用户的金币操作历史。
设计数据库表结构:
根据应用需求设计合理的数据库表结构,用于存储用户信息、广告数据、游戏数据、金币记录等。
优化数据库性能:
对数据库进行索引优化、查询优化等,提高数据访问速度和系统性能。
单元测试:
对各个模块进行单元测试,确保功能正确无误。
集成测试:
将前端和后端集成起来进行测试,验证整体功能的协调性和稳定性。
性能测试:
对应用进行性能测试,包括压力测试、响应时间测试等,确保应用能够承受大量用户同时访问。
优化:
根据测试结果对源码进行优化,提升应用的性能和用户体验。
准备发布材料:
如应用图标、描述、关键词等。
提交审核:
将应用提交至苹果App Store、Google Play和其他安卓应用市场进行审核。
上线推广:
通过社交媒体营销、合作伙伴推广等方式吸引用户。
数据分析:
收集用户行为数据,分析用户偏好和广告效果。
优化广告策略:
根据数据分析结果调整广告展示策略,提高广告收益。
持续迭代:
根据用户反馈和市场需求,不断优化产品功能和用户体验。
运营维护:
监控应用的运行情况,及时处理用户反馈和问题。
定期更新应用,添加新功能、优化现有功能或修复漏洞。
请注意,以上步骤仅提供了一个大致的框架,具体的实现细节将取决于你的具体需求和项目规模。在开发过程中,务必关注安全性、隐私保护、用户体验优化等方面的问题,并遵守相关法律法规的要求。
联系方式
- 电 话:13724186946
- 联系人:王松松
- 手 机:13724186946
- 微 信:13724186946